Boehner reiterates call for Clinton to turn over server

Despite evidence to the contrary, Secretary Clinton continues to maintain that she never had classified emails. Now let's not be foolish," Boehner told reporters at a regular news conference.

"She knows exactly how classifying materials works. At this point the best thing for Mrs. Clinton to do is to come clean and just turn the server over to the IG (inspector general) at the State Department."

The information was classified at the time the emails were sent, according to the inspector general,Charles McCullough.

"This classified information should never have been transmitted via an unclassified personal system," McCullough said in a joint statement on Friday along with his equivalent at the State Department, Steve Linick.
